pta打印九九口诀表六个就换行C语言
时间: 2024-11-13 14:25:14 浏览: 16
在C语言中,如果你想要编写一个程序来打印九九乘法口诀表,并且每打印到第6个数就自动换行,你可以使用循环结构和控制打印的内容来实现。下面是一个简单的示例:
```c
#include <stdio.h>
void print_multiplication_table(int n) {
for (int i = 1; i <= n; i++) { // 行数循环
for (int j = 1; j <= i; j++) { // 列数循环
if ((i * j) % 6 == 0) { // 当乘积能被6整除时换行
printf("\n");
}
printf("%d*%d=%-2d ", j, i, i*j); // 输出乘积,保证对齐
}
printf("\n"); // 每一行结束后换行
}
}
int main() {
int n = 9; // 可以调整这个值来改变打印范围
print_multiplication_table(n);
return 0;
}
```
这个程序会打印出从1到`n`的九九乘法表,如果当前乘积能够被6整除(表示到了新的一行),就会自动换行。
相关问题
ptaJava打印九九乘法表
在Java中,可以使用嵌套循环来打印九九乘法表。以下是一个示例代码:
```java
public class PrintMultiplicationTable {
public static void main(String[] args) {
for (int i = 1; i <= 9; i++) {
for (int j = 1; j <= i; j++) {
System.out.print(j + " * " + i + " = " + (i * j) + "\t");
}
System.out.println();
}
}
}
```
这段代码使用两个嵌套的for循环,外层循环控制行数,内层循环控制每行的列数。通过`System.out.print`打印每个乘法表达式,并使用`\t`进行制表符对齐。最后使用`System.out.println`换行。
pta打印直角九九乘法表
PTA,通常是指家长教师协会(Parent-Teacher Association),这是一个非营利组织,旨在加强学校、家庭和社区之间的合作。如果提到pta打印直角九九乘法表,可能是指某个PTA活动或资源中的一部分内容,即帮助孩子们学习乘法的一种教学工具。
直角九九乘法表是一种传统的方式,用于展示1到9的数字两两相乘的结果,通常是按照一个45度对角线布局的表格形式。例如:
```
1 2 3 4 5 6 7 8 9
+---+---+---+---+---+---+---+---+---
1 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9
+---+---+---+---+---+---+---+---+---
2 | 2 | 4 | 6 | 8 |10 |12 |14 |16 |18
+--+---+---+---+---+---+---+---+---
4 | 4 | 8 |12 |16 |20 |24 |28 |32 |36
+---+---+---+---+---+---+---+---+---
5 | 5 |10 |15 |20 |25 |30 |35 |40 |45
+---+---+---+---+---+---+---+---+---
6 | 6 |12 |18 |24 |30 |36 |42 |48 |54
+--+---+---+---+---+---+---+---+---
8 | 8 |16 |24 |32 |40 |48 |56 |64 |72
+---+---+---+---+---+---+---+---+---
9 | 9 |18 |27 |36 |45 |54 |63 |72 |81
+---+---+---+---+---+---+---+---+---
每个格子内的数字表示左上角的数乘以右下角的数的结果。对于PTA来说,这可能是一个教育资源,可以用来在学校活动中教授数学基础,或者是作为手工制作的教具提供给学生。如果你需要打印这样的表格,可以在网上找到模板或用电子表格软件如Microsoft Excel自动生成。
阅读全文